Virat Kohli included in Delhi's probables list for Ranji Trophy 2024-25 for first time since 2019

Delhi and District Cricket Association (DDCA) announced the 84-member probables list for the Ranji Trophy, which is likely to be truncated to 15-20 for the final squad. The 2024-25 edition of India's premier domestic red-ball competition begins on October 11.

Former India captain and batting stalwart Virat Kohli has been included in his domestic team Delhi's Ranji Trophy probables for the first time since 2019-20. Kohli is unlikely to play the Ranji Trophy since it clashes with India's Test assignments against New Zealand at home and Australia away, hence, his inclusion was a bit of a surprise. Not just Kohli, but Rishabh Pant, who played the inaugural match of the Delhi Premier League (DPL) for Purani Dilli-6, is also included in the long list of 84 players for India's premier domestic red-ball competition, which kicks off on October 11.

Kohli, who last played a domestic game in 2012/13 season for Delhi in the Ranji Trophy, missed the Duleep Trophy fixture in the first round, alongside Indian skipper Rohit Sharma when several current Test players got into the red-ball mindset ahead of the start of the long season for the national side. 

"A fitness test for the selected players will take place on 26th September 2024. Players currently on international duty are exempt from this fitness test," a DDCA release read while announcing the probables list.

Most of the Delhi state players are named in the squad including many of them participated in the inaugural DPL T20, whom for the first time, everyone saw on the big stage. Pacers Navdeep Saini, Mayank Yadav, Harshit Rana, Himanshu Chauhan and Divij Mehra all found a place in the probables list, however, Ishant Sharma was the notable name missing from such a long list.
